UVa looks to rebound against talented TCU

It was an ugly night on the gridiron for Virginia last Saturday, as it was embarrassed at home by William & Mary, 26-14. The Cavaliers looked flat and unprepared, and too many mistakes resulted in a shocking loss that led to disbelief and dissatisfaction from the fan base. Now, UVa will face the unenviable task of having to right the ship against 16th-ranked TCU, which heads to Charlottesville on Saturday for its season opener with a well deserved reputation as one of the nation's most dominant defensive teams.
